2. Popular learning driving direction control skills
According to recent hot discussions on driving learning, the following are several directional control skills that students are most concerned about:
| Skills | Description | Popular index |
|---|---|---|
| hands holding posture | 9 o'clock on the left hand, 3 o'clock on the right hand | ★★★★★ |
| Fine-tune the direction | Make small corrections in direction to avoid big moves | ★★★★☆ |
| sight guidance | Look far away rather than near, the direction is more stable | ★★★★★ |
| Vehicle speed control | The direction is more sensitive at low speed, please pay attention | ★★★☆☆ |
3. Analysis of recent hot issues in driving learning
According to data from major driving test forums and social platforms, the following are the five most common direction control problems encountered by students in the past 10 days:
| Ranking | question | solution |
|---|---|---|
| 1 | How much to turn the steering wheel | Flexibly adjust according to the turning radius. Generally, one turn is made at 90 degrees. |
| 2 | Straight driving deviation | Keep your gaze far away, fine-tune your direction, and don’t hold the steering wheel tightly |
| 3 | The direction of reversing into the garage is confusing | Remember the principle of "hit wherever the rear of the car goes" |
| 4 | Unstable direction control in curves | Slow down before entering a corner and maintain a constant speed through the corner |
| 5 | Drifting in high speed direction | Hold your hands lightly to avoid overcorrection |
4. Advanced skills in direction control
After you master the basics of directional control, try the following advanced techniques, which have been getting a lot of attention in driving instruction videos lately:
1.Predictive driving: Fine-tune the direction in advance according to road conditions instead of waiting to correct it after it deviates.
2.muscle memory training: Develop steering wheel feel through practice in simulators or open fields.
3.Coping with different road conditions: Master the difference in direction control under special circumstances such as slippery roads and slopes.
4.Blind spot inspection skills: When changing lanes, look in the rearview mirror before turning to ensure safety.
